#a9c448 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a9c448 is composed of 66.3% red, 76.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 73.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.2% and a lightness of 52.5%. #a9c448 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#538900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#a9c448 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a9c448 has RGB values of R:169, G:196,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 11125832.

Shades and Tints of #a9c448
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a03 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a9c448
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898c80 is the less saturated color, while #c9fc10 is the most saturated one.
